The Functionality of Floor Mirrors in a Dressing Room

First and foremost, let's talk about the functionality of floor mirrors in a dressing room. A dressing room is a space where people go to try on clothes, accessorize, and get ready for the day or an event. In this context, a floor mirror is an essential tool. It allows you to see your entire outfit at once, from head to toe. This comprehensive view is crucial for assessing how different pieces of clothing fit together, whether a particular style flatters your body shape, and if the overall look is balanced.

For example, when trying on a long evening gown, a floor mirror enables you to check the length, the way the fabric drapes, and how the train flows behind you. Without a full - length view, you might miss important details that could affect the overall appearance of the outfit.

Moreover, floor mirrors are also useful for checking your posture. When you stand in front of a floor mirror, you can easily spot if you are slouching or if your shoulders are uneven. This awareness can help you correct your posture, which not only makes you look more confident but also has long - term health benefits.

Practical Considerations

When using a floor mirror in a dressing room, there are also some practical considerations to keep in mind. One of the most important factors is the placement of the mirror. You want to place it in an area where it gets adequate lighting. Natural light is ideal, as it provides a true and accurate reflection of your appearance. If natural light is not available, you can use artificial lighting, such as LED strip lights or wall sconces, to illuminate the mirror.

Another consideration is the stability of the mirror. Since floor mirrors are large and heavy, they need to be securely placed. You can choose a mirror with a sturdy base or mount it to the wall for added stability. This is especially important if there are children or pets in the house, as an unstable mirror could pose a safety hazard.

Space Optimization

Floor mirrors can also be used to optimize the space in a dressing room. Mirrors have the optical illusion of making a room appear larger and more open. By strategically placing a floor mirror on a wall, you can create the impression of a more spacious dressing room. For example, if you have a small dressing room, placing a mirror on the opposite wall of the door can make the room seem longer. If the room is narrow, a mirror on one of the side walls can make it appear wider.

Maintenance

Maintaining a floor mirror in a dressing room is relatively easy. Regular cleaning with a glass cleaner and a soft cloth is usually sufficient to keep the mirror looking its best. You should also avoid using abrasive materials or harsh chemicals, as these can damage the mirror's surface.
